Automates data synchronization and backup between local and network files or folders. Fast bidirectional replication moving files and directories. Can be installed as a Windows NT/2000 Service. Idem can check and copy the files and folders security informations (ACL permissions -access-control lists on NTFS partitions) and the files and folders attributes(hidden, system, archive, etc.) Special feature : Fully preserves Macintosh filenames and structures stored on a Windows NT 4.0 server. Option to remove old files and subfolders from target folders and to rename moved Macintosh files, substituting a dash to the forbidden Windows characters int heir names.
What is new in this release:
- You can now display locked files that were not copied during the last mirroring cycle using menu Configuration / Display locked files (F3).
- When 'Record files and folders names in Log files' is set in menu 'Logs/Archive mirroring operations in Log files' menu, locked files are recorded in Log.
- When running Idem for a long period, reserved handlers were not always correctly released, leading to abnormal increasing of memory and unexpected crash due to memory leak.
- More robust test to check locked files before copying them. Before this fix, most locked files - opened Word documents for example - were correctly detected and not copied. But some other locked files - like Outlook.pst when Outlook is running - were not properly detected. This has been fixed and improved.
